timber frame: What to Expect at a Log Home and Timber Frame Show - 10/12/08 10:59 AM
No matter where you may be in the log home building process, from mildly curious to a serious buyer, there is nothing as enlightening or useful as attending a log home show.  Having the opportunity to meet and talk with manufacturers, builders and dealers face-to-face lets you ask them all your questions and compare their answers.
As an example, companies that ‘kiln dry' their logs have a different story to tell than those that air-dry logs and each method has advantages you will want to consider.  Discussing these sales points and conflicting viewpoints will help you draw your own conclusions as … (6 comments)
